What are the names of the father and son presidents?

The first US Presidents who were father and son were John Adams and John Quincy Adams (the 2nd President and the 6th President). George H. W. Bush and George W. Bush are the second and most recent father-son pair that were US Presidents (the 41st and 43rd US Presidents).

Were the father-son US Presidents part of the Republican or Democratic Party?

President George H.W. Bush and his son President George W. Bush are both Republicans. President John Adams was a Federalist and his son President John Quincy Adams was a Democratic-Republican. President William Henry Harrison was a Whig and his grandson President Benjamin Harrison was a Republican.
